Sleep

Phospher icons - Vue - Vue.js Supplied #.\n\nPhosphor is actually a flexible icon household for user interfaces, representations, presentations-- whatever, actually. Explore all images at phosphoricons.com.\nRecreation space.\nVisit our playing field in StackBlitz as well as begin exploring!\n\nSetup.\nyarn add @phosphor- icons\/vue.\nor.\nnpm put in @phosphor- icons\/vue.\nUtilization.\n\n\n\n\n\n\n\nInternational mount.\nAllthough we highly dissuade installing your images around the world, you can do therefore through enrolling it in your application as complies with:.\nimport createApp coming from 'vue'.\nbring in Application from '.\/ App.vue'.\nimport PhosphorIcons from \"@phosphor- icons\/vue\".\n\npermit application = createApp( App).\n\napp.use( PhosphorIcons).\n\napp.mount('

app').Why perform our experts advise against global installs?Bundlers including Vite as well as Webpack count on ESM bring ins to carry out tree-shaking. When you install entire public library worldwide, you lose the capacity to perform tree-shaking, because all elements are enrolled within vue, as well as the bundler can easily not recognize which elements are really used in your application.Props.Symbol parts accept all characteristics that you can easily exchange an ordinary SVG element, consisting of inline height/width, x/y, opacity, plus @click and other v-on users. The major way of designating them are going to generally be with the observing props:.shade?: cord-- Image stroke/fill different colors. Could be any type of CSS colour string, featuring hex, rgb, rgba, hsl, hsla, named colors, or the unique currentColor variable.measurements?: amount|strand-- Symbol height &amp width. As with standard React components, this may be a number, or even a string with systems in px, %, em, rapid eye movement, pt, centimeters, mm, in.mass?: "slim"|"light"|"normal"|"daring"|"filler"|"duotone"-- Image weight/style. Could be made use of, for example, to "toggle" an image's condition: a score element can utilize Fate along with body weight=" regular" to denote an empty superstar, and body weight=" filler" to show a loaded celebrity.mirrored?: boolean-- Turn the image horizontally. May be beneficial in RTL foreign languages where regular symbol positioning is actually not ideal.Composition.Phosphor makes use of Vue's provide/inject options to make administering a nonpayment style to all images straightforward. Generate a give item or function at the origin of the application (or even anywhere above the icons in the tree) that sends back a setup things along with props to be applied through default to all images below it in the tree:./ * I'm lime-green, 32px, as well as bold! *// * Me also! *// * Me 3:-RRB- */
You might produce several suppliers for styling icons in different ways in distinct locations of a request symbols use the local service provider above them to identify their type.Keep in mind: The color, dimension, weight, as well as represented features are actually all extra props when developing a circumstance, but nonpayment to "currentColor", "1em", "frequent" and also inaccurate.Ports.Components possess a for arbitrary SVG factors, as long as they stand little ones of the aspect. This may be utilized to modify an icon with background levels or even forms, filters, animations as well as more. The slotted kids will definitely be actually put below the ordinary icon materials.The adhering to will certainly trigger the Dice symbol to rotate and also pulse:.
Keep in mind: The correlative room of slotted factors is actually relative to the components of the icon viewBox, which is actually a 256x256 square. Merely legitimate SVG factors will definitely be actually rendered.Development.This repository leverages git-submodules to remain up-to-date along with the phosphor-icons/core database, which implies that for regional developoment, you'll need to clone this storehouse along with the-- recurse-submodules git clone flag.After you've effectively duplicated the repository, you are going to locate a core directory consisting of the previously mentioned center storehouse.Today you may put up all regional addictions along with npm set up and begin establishing.Task construct./ bin: Keeps the assembly script, which utilizes the raw SVG symbol documents coming from the core directory to put together all Vue elements./ core: Git submodule directory site for the primary database./ dist: Will definitely be generated upon developing the library as well as holds all dist bundles./ node_modules: You must recognize now what this directory concerns./ src: Holds the access factor for this public library.Assembling.To assemble the Vue components you are going to require to manage npm operate construct. This will definitely loop with all symbols in the/ core/assets directory site as well as produce all Vue components consisting of all body weights as well as setup props. These Vue parts are at that point spared under/ src/components which are going to after that be utilized by the bundler to generate the ultimate plan bunch.NOTE: Upon duplicating this storehouse, the/ src/components directory site performs certainly not exist yet. You are going to first need to manage the put together manuscript for this directory site to become generated.Relevant Projects.

Articles You Can Be Interested In